Ā The one I made is in Tunisian Crochet, main body is tunisian knit stitch and I used Wool ease thick and quick (I used the bonus skeins which have alot more yarn, it uses alot of yarn and it's really heavy).

For these cocoon style cardigans, you pretty much make a rectangle, the width should be how wide your back is plus whatever extra you want for how long your sleeves will be, then you fold the top and the bottom to meet in the middle and a few inches on each side which are your arm holes. Ā Some different blogs have diagrams explaining this better.
